GRIMES, Acting Chief Judge.
The issue presented on this appeal is whether a stockholder who dissents from the sale of his corporation's assets is a creditor under Florida's bulk transfer statutes, Chapter 676, Florida Statutes (1975).
Jim Harrell Pontiac, Inc. was an Alabama corporation which operated an automobile agency in Tampa. On October 30, 1975, this corporation entered into a written agreement to sell its assets to Bay Pontiac Company (now Superior...
